-
74f6e540e2
Support for canceling preprocess tasks -- fixes Bug #9
Wenzel Jakob
2010-09-14 01:45:24 +0200
-
59ff88d45a
initialization-related bugfixes
Wenzel Jakob
2010-09-14 00:51:09 +0200
-
43baf60019
forgotten cout
Wenzel Jakob
2010-09-14 00:21:35 +0200
-
fe4b174e52
more cleanups
Wenzel Jakob
2010-09-14 00:13:27 +0200
-
943aca4016
faster sutherland-hodgman iteration, added missing partial specialization for integer division involving vectors
Wenzel Jakob
2010-09-13 22:36:51 +0200
-
486597b420
merge with default local branch
Wenzel Jakob
2010-09-13 21:46:01 +0200
-
-
-
-
7ecd3a5e73
updated nvidia suppressions file for valgrind, fixed path resolution error in mitsuba.cpp
Wenzel Jakob
2010-09-13 21:35:46 +0200
-
a5035b6b10
partial rewrite part 2, the project now fully compiles again
Wenzel Jakob
2010-09-13 21:19:04 +0200
-
d9d4a00522
updated acknowledgements, show whether collada is compiled into the binary
Wenzel Jakob
2010-09-13 16:44:12 +0200
-
1d39bd053f
nicer update dialog (only UI file for now)
Wenzel Jakob
2010-09-12 12:36:25 +0200
-
1390cc6763
Feedback & bugreport menu items
Wenzel Jakob
2010-09-12 11:56:39 +0200
-
9ac6d2c145
Nicer hgignore, forgotten fresolver.cpp file
Wenzel Jakob
2010-09-12 11:48:34 +0200
-
8e7fdb48dc
Partial rewrite, part 1. Does not fully compile yet
Wenzel Jakob
2010-09-10 03:14:48 +0200
-
-
6fb1691861
typo in compilation documentation
Wenzel Jakob
2010-09-08 23:37:24 +0200
-
a8b1d882ef
nicer geometry debug messages
Wenzel Jakob
2010-09-08 11:32:58 +0200
-
bd71ae8147
OSX cleanups
Wenzel Jakob
2010-09-08 11:23:40 +0200
-
e7d808d6e7
fix an apparent portability issue regarding std::isstream between OSX and Linux
Wenzel Jakob
2010-09-08 10:36:30 +0200
-
234e1a724d
merged with the main branch
Wenzel Jakob
2010-09-08 10:21:36 +0200
-
-
b0663fc4fe
fixed debian changelog
Wenzel Jakob
2010-09-08 08:00:29 +0000
-
-
ff65f63879
Added tag v0.1.3 for changeset 79c172eb257c
Wenzel Jakob
2010-09-08 09:56:19 +0200
-
cde6d7d462
Version 0.1.3
Wenzel Jakob
2010-09-08 09:56:07 +0200
-
c6c261e724
store relative paths in imported scenes
Wenzel Jakob
2010-09-07 17:34:53 -0700
-
1c8f3f0745
fixed coherent ray tracer intensities for point sources
Wenzel Jakob
2010-09-08 02:17:46 +0200
-
3de850f4e2
fix point sources in the RTRT preview
Wenzel Jakob
2010-09-08 01:55:50 +0200
-
0dc517bfa4
fixed incorrect shadow map extents
Wenzel Jakob
2010-09-08 01:14:50 +0200
-
65e8b96185
GLSL implementation of the Ward BRDF
Wenzel Jakob
2010-09-08 01:05:07 +0200
-
9ed2a00c97
fix incorrect tangent vectors passed to the shader
Wenzel Jakob
2010-09-08 00:51:59 +0200
-
da64e93eb5
larger default shadow bias
Wenzel Jakob
2010-09-08 00:39:26 +0200
-
f5d7d89e97
gamma computation bugfix
Wenzel Jakob
2010-09-08 00:39:05 +0200
-
6e58b602d9
fixed a serious bug regarding VBOs and calls to glDrawElements
Wenzel Jakob
2010-09-08 00:07:35 +0200
-
e1351b6c76
complain when compiling invalid GLSL programs
Wenzel Jakob
2010-09-07 22:44:35 +0200
-
4d8cc8d764
nicer snprintf() behavior
Wenzel Jakob
2010-09-07 22:24:48 +0200
-
11a47e1851
fixed bug in phong GLSL preview
Wenzel Jakob
2010-09-07 22:02:40 +0200
-
ae39518ca0
fixed a glaring bug related to Phong/Ward/Microfacet and textures, Faster ldrtexture loading times
Wenzel Jakob
2010-09-07 21:50:30 +0200
-
ced3b423e4
merged with main branch from repository
Steve Marschner
2010-09-07 16:53:39 +0200
-
-
bab8d27301
fix for duplicated final vertex bug
Steve Marschner
2010-09-07 16:49:35 +0200
-
e05818a1a6
merge with main branch
Wenzel Jakob
2010-09-06 11:46:41 +0200
-
-
0b6812cb87
GLEW version check
Wenzel Jakob
2010-09-05 22:36:29 +0200
-
92a627986f
better path handling
Wenzel Jakob
2010-09-05 21:51:30 +0200
-
211f17aa98
fix some memory management-related issues
Wenzel Jakob
2010-09-05 21:31:49 +0200
-
8486931b30
Nicer testcase framework, eigendecomposition support
Wenzel Jakob
2010-09-05 21:17:35 +0200
-
debd09e75f
automatic multiprocessor builds, fix compilation when COLLADA is missing
Wenzel Jakob
2010-09-05 17:09:06 +0200
-
3d3048f7de
convert module names to lower case
Wenzel Jakob
2010-09-05 15:36:23 +0200
-
76a9a6b4d0
import chapter
Wenzel Jakob
2010-09-03 17:59:20 +0200
-
952a2daee3
OSX build fixes
Wenzel Jakob
2010-09-03 17:48:40 +0200
-
-
43003e88d1
updated changelog
Wenzel Jakob
2010-09-03 15:17:29 +0000
-
2b9b7f2b25
version switch -> 0.1.2
Wenzel Jakob
2010-09-03 17:00:08 +0200
-
c1dae502b1
Added tag v0.1.2 for changeset 9486893d5591
Wenzel Jakob
2010-09-03 16:59:59 +0200
-
82596daa50
documentation: import chapter
Wenzel Jakob
2010-09-03 16:58:59 +0200
-
4e5a9af233
more uniform material parameter names -- ward
Wenzel Jakob
2010-09-03 15:47:54 +0200
-
d4ae5660cf
BMP loading support, material parameter naming more uniform
Wenzel Jakob
2010-09-03 15:26:18 +0200
-
d4181b01fd
import tutorial
Wenzel Jakob
2010-09-03 14:20:18 +0200
-
151ab2311a
better to be on the safe side
Wenzel Jakob
2010-09-03 14:00:32 +0200
-
ff71d8f041
fixed title
Wenzel Jakob
2010-09-03 13:35:01 +0200
-
c26e577b65
windows build fixes
Wenzel Jakob
2010-09-03 13:20:46 +0200
-
f80535f543
ignore duplicate geometry when importing
Wenzel Jakob
2010-09-03 09:37:58 +0200
-
ab7961df0c
use less compression when serializing geometry files (much faster)
Wenzel Jakob
2010-09-03 00:24:44 +0200
-
eedf35f4eb
bugfix to the composite material
Wenzel Jakob
2010-09-03 00:18:43 +0200
-
0f1158c678
added copyright headers to all relevant source files
Wenzel Jakob
2010-09-02 23:41:20 +0200
-
dc8aed1aaf
merged with main branch
Wenzel Jakob
2010-09-02 22:39:27 +0200
-
-
-
995810faaf
do sphere & cylinder intersections in double precision
Wenzel Jakob
2010-09-02 22:32:33 +0200
-
1cf68695d2
removal of unused code
Wenzel Jakob
2010-09-02 21:52:25 +0200
-
9fcc46643b
adaptive ray epsilon
Wenzel Jakob
2010-09-02 21:50:17 +0200
-
0b8863f2cb
nicer testcase runner
Wenzel Jakob
2010-09-02 18:05:49 +0200
-
1c60e7368d
testcase support -- see 'test_samplers.cpp' for an example
Wenzel Jakob
2010-09-02 17:57:04 +0200
-
e0b52ef022
cleanups, brought volume file format up to spec
Wenzel Jakob
2010-09-02 03:25:53 +0200
-
575beeb792
allow changing the navigation mode
Wenzel Jakob
2010-09-02 02:21:02 +0200
-
2f6e02abf3
more natural stop/preview button behavior
Wenzel Jakob
2010-09-02 01:31:52 +0200
-
20c5a58cf4
get rid of the QTDIR path detection warning
Wenzel Jakob
2010-09-02 00:32:11 +0200
-
96bc8e0422
brought the OSX preview settings dialog up to date
Wenzel Jakob
2010-09-01 23:39:55 +0200
-
8c0e6e3d18
committed miter hair segment code from Steve
Wenzel Jakob
2010-09-01 22:41:59 +0200
-
-
906f5910fd
import transparent surfaces
Wenzel Jakob
2010-08-31 23:38:23 +0200
-
4044fad4da
forgot material indirection for polylist imports
Wenzel Jakob
2010-08-31 22:55:22 +0200
-
6e181dcab3
better deal with zero-area triangles, misc. fixes
Wenzel Jakob
2010-08-31 22:32:34 +0200
-
2527bb0dec
area light source bugfix, return to preview button
Wenzel Jakob
2010-08-31 21:17:15 +0200
-
e2b860610c
matrix support
Wenzel Jakob
2010-08-31 03:35:45 +0200
-
559af6f2b3
typo/bugfix
Wenzel Jakob
2010-08-31 02:44:43 +0200
-
a00438551f
collada import of SketchUp scenes improved, still buggy
Wenzel Jakob
2010-08-31 02:36:12 +0200
-
02c47237a7
vast collada importer improvements, incomplete bmp loading support
Wenzel Jakob
2010-08-31 00:23:34 +0200
-
715a854199
merged with main branch
Wenzel Jakob
2010-08-30 21:41:35 +0200
-
-
2650e9f5cb
transparent compression support
Wenzel Jakob
2010-08-30 21:40:32 +0200
-
369e5db618
ZAE support
Wenzel Jakob
2010-08-30 20:12:23 +0200
-
a6075d7439
trap when throwing exceptions while the program is being debugged
Wenzel Jakob
2010-08-30 11:09:40 +0200
-
73f5f5fc4b
added mersenne twister to acknowledgments
Wenzel Jakob
2010-08-30 10:24:19 +0200
-
45b381d0ac
fixed infinite recursion possibility in the VPL generator
Wenzel Jakob
2010-08-30 10:14:24 +0200
-
3b77937d78
fixed infinite recursion possibility in the path tracer
Wenzel Jakob
2010-08-30 10:12:37 +0200
-
-
25730ec2eb
merge with main branch
Wenzel Jakob
2010-08-30 09:33:03 +0200
-
-
c5e2868853
typo
Wenzel Jakob
2010-08-30 08:54:03 +0200
-
622dfa78f7
some bugfixes, nicer importer XML output
Wenzel Jakob
2010-08-30 08:49:01 +0200
-
-
715c0589f7
finished feature to force diffuse materials
Wenzel Jakob
2010-08-28 22:31:14 +0200
-
c296248190
preview: allow forcing diffuse sources/receivers -- the latter is not done yet
Wenzel Jakob
2010-08-28 22:10:05 +0200
-
e191ea43c9
fix problems with the server not binding to the correct interface
Wenzel Jakob
2010-08-27 20:21:08 +0200
-
723e8d951f
fixed obj serialization issues
Wenzel Jakob
2010-08-27 15:33:22 +0200
-
1c550cc024
insist on the correct locale
Wenzel Jakob
2010-08-27 11:07:39 +0200
-
e5dbed44e6
fix ugly buttons on OSX
Wenzel Jakob
2010-08-27 10:08:01 +0200
-
1d2dfda4c8
import scenes in a separate thread
Wenzel Jakob
2010-08-27 09:45:33 +0200
-
f231d57b7a
prevent radioactive phong materials
Wenzel Jakob
2010-08-27 01:37:20 +0200
-
eaf8ba36cb
allow making VPLs diffuse for faster preview convergence
Wenzel Jakob
2010-08-27 01:22:48 +0200
-
271d1bbded
better tooltips for the preview settings
Wenzel Jakob
2010-08-26 23:32:37 +0200
-
ebbd817a52
some some visual feedback that the scene is being imported
Wenzel Jakob
2010-08-26 19:56:36 +0200